A novel ranging technique based on orthogonal frequency division multiplexing (OFDM) is proposed for the ranging systems in space by using the properties of OFDM in time and frequency domains. The coarse estimation of the time delay is obtained by the correlation of the waveforms of OFDM signals in the time domain, and the fine estimation of the time delay is obtained by the phase differences between the subcarriers in the frequency domain by the proposed method. The simulation results show that the performance of the proposed technique is better than that of the pseudonoise ranging method and that of the phase ranging method.
